Q: Is 3,351,018 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,351,018 is a composite number.

Why is 3,351,018 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,351,018 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 11 22 33 66 50,773 101,546 152,319 304,638 558,503 1,117,006 1,675,509 and 3,351,018, with no remainder.

Since 3,351,018 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,351,018, it is a composite number.
